Starters and Small Plates

The starters at The View House are designed to awaken the appetite and set the tone for the meal ahead. This section of the menu features an enticing mix of light, flavorful options that pair beautifully with the restaurant’s signature cocktails or a glass of wine.

The small plates encourage sharing, making them perfect for groups or couples looking to sample a variety of tastes.

Each appetizer showcases a balance of textures and fresh ingredients, often highlighting seasonal produce. The culinary team takes pride in crafting dishes that are visually appealing as well as delicious, ensuring the first course leaves a lasting impression.

Guests can expect choices ranging from crispy calamari to vibrant salads and artisanal flatbreads. The emphasis on bold yet balanced flavors offers something for everyone, whether you prefer something spicy, tangy, or subtly sweet.

  • Calamari Fritti: Lightly breaded and fried to a golden crisp, served with a zesty aioli.
  • Heirloom Tomato Salad: A colorful medley of tomatoes, fresh basil, and burrata cheese.
  • Artisan Flatbread: Topped with caramelized onions, goat cheese, and a drizzle of balsamic glaze.

Comparative Highlights of Entrées

Dish Main Ingredient Preparation Style Recommended Pairing
Seared Ahi Tuna Yellowfin Tuna Lightly seared, served rare Chardonnay
Grilled Ribeye USDA Prime Beef Char-grilled with herb butter Cabernet Sauvignon
Wild Mushroom Risotto Seasonal Wild Mushrooms Creamy, slow-cooked arborio rice Pinot Noir

Seafood Specialties

Given its coastal location, The View House menu highlights an impressive array of seafood dishes that emphasize freshness and sustainable sourcing. This section is a testament to the culinary team’s expertise in preparing fish and shellfish that capture the essence of the sea.

From delicate ceviche to robust seafood platters, guests can indulge in a variety of flavors and textures. The menu balances traditional preparations with modern twists, appealing to both seafood aficionados and curious diners.

Seasonal availability dictates much of the seafood selection, ensuring that every dish is made with ingredients at their peak. The chefs’ skillful use of herbs, spices, and complementary sides elevates each offering to a memorable dining experience.

Popular Seafood Choices

  • Grilled Local Halibut: Paired with a lemon beurre blanc and seasonal vegetables.
  • Seafood Cioppino: A hearty tomato broth with clams, mussels, shrimp, and fish.
  • Spicy Tuna Tartare: Fresh ahi tuna with avocado and a chili-lime dressing.
